>>> Exclude VRFB from OMAP4 onwards and include only for
>>> OMAP2 and OMAP3 builds.  In OMAP4 VRFB HW IP is replaced
>>> with a new HW IP "TILER"
>>> 
>>> --- a/drivers/video/omap2/Kconfig
>>> +++ b/drivers/video/omap2/Kconfig
>>> @@ -3,6 +3,10 @@ config OMAP2_VRAM
>>> 
>>> config OMAP2_VRFB
>>>     bool
>>> +   depends on FB_OMAP2 && (!ARCH_OMAP4)
>>> +   default y if (ARCH_OMAP2 || ARCH_OMAP3)
>>> +   help
>>> +     OMAP VRFB buffer support is efficient for rotation
>> 
>> How does this work for multi-omap kernels, e.g. building a 
>> kernel with beagle and panda support?
